eSecLending expands business development team
eSecLending has boosted its business development team with the hires of Erik Skulte as vice president, US business development and Nora Bowman as vice president, client relationship management.
Skulte will be responsible for the continued growth and expansion of the firm’s securities financing business. He has worked in securities lending, emerging markets, fixed income financing sales, liquidity management, and short duration sales during his 20 years in finance.

Skulte joins from Deutsche Bank where he was director of short duration sales. Before this he was at Royal Bank of Scotland also spent eight years at Lehman Brothers in roles of increased responsibility in the company’s US and international markets.
Nora Bowman will serve as the primary point of contact for designated US based clients, managing service delivery and overseeing all elements of the client programs.

Bowman was most recently assistant vice president, relationship management at State Street Corporation, where she managed relationships with the company’s mutual fund and pension fund clients in the securities lending division.
